[QUOTE="bassboy1, post: 177606, member: 55"] Put some structure back. A clone of the rib would be ideal. However, the seat also provides torsional strength. Take the benches out, and the whole boat will corkscrew like crazy. If you are putting a deck in, this shouldn't be a problem, as you are replacing the structure (these will be tensional forces running diagonally across the horizontal surface - deck, bench top, deck structure, if stiff enough, and so on) but if you are leaving the entire boat open, you're going to get some flex.
